Company description:
New Zealand Police is working with the community to make New Zealanders be safe and feel safe. With over 13,000 staff, we provide policing services 24 hours a day, every day. We operate by land, sea and air, manage over 860,000 emergency calls a year and are always actively preventing crime and crashes.

About the role
We are recruiting staff for our Te Waipounamu region, based in our Nelson and Dunedin centres.
Please note, it is rostered work shift and you will be working on a shift\ rotation..
Nelson Centre, shift work is Monday to Friday, a mixture of early and late shifts. Early shifts is 0630hrs – 1430hrs, Late shifts 1400hrs – 2200hrs.
Dunedin Centre, shift work is six days on, three days off, consisting of three early shifts 0600-1400hrs and three late shifts 1400hrs-2200hrs.
As part of the File Management and Transcription (FM&T) workgroup, you will be part of a team that delivers operational and administrational support to front line staff, victims, and external agencies at District and Regional level. Once trained, you will be expected to work and access several Police IT systems to process information of varied priority and level of risk.
A File Management Support Officer will be able to work confidently in a fast-paced team environment, be committed to contributing to and being part of a high performing team and have a clear understanding of “Our Business†and our “Police Valuesâ€.
To support District/Regional outcomes, a File Management Support Officer will provide an end to end Case Management service of Police files in entry and modification to meet organisational demand.
